Health Benefits of Eating Watermelon
Watermelons are incredibly nutritious- and there’s so many reasons why we should eat them all year long- but especially when they are ripe and fresh and juicy in the Summer.
Hydration: Watermelon is composed of over 90% water, making it an excellent choice to help you stay hydrated especially on those hot summer days!
Nutrient-rich: Watermelon is a good source of vitamins A, C, and B6. These are important for immune function, vision, and skin health. It also contains minerals like potassium and magnesium.
Antioxidant properties: Watermelon is rich in antioxidants like lycopene, beta-carotene, and vitamin C. These compounds help neutralize harmful free radicals in the body, reducing the risk of chronic diseases.
Low in calories making them an excellent choice for a healthy snack and aiding in weight loss efforts
Heart health: The lycopene content in watermelon has been associated with heart health benefits. It may help lower cholesterol levels, reduce inflammation, and improve blood pressure.
Hydrating for the skin: The high water content in watermelon can contribute to skin hydration and help maintain a healthy complexion.
Exercise recovery: Watermelon contains the amino acid citrulline, which has been found to aid in post-exercise muscle recovery, reduce muscle soreness, and improve athletic performance.
Eye health: Watermelon is a source of beta-carotene, which the body converts into vitamin A. Adequate vitamin A is essential for good eye health and may help protect against age-related macular degeneration and night blindness.
Digestive health: Watermelon is rich in fiber, which can aid in digestion and promote regular bowel movements.
Kidney function: Watermelon has diuretic properties, which means it can increase urine production and help flush out toxins, potentially benefiting kidney function.
Summer-Ready Watermelon Recipes
When it comes to making delicious recipes with watermelons this season, there are plenty of options available! Here are some simple and refreshing watermelon recipes that are sure to delight your taste buds while providing essential nutrition:
Watermelon Salad
Toss together cubes of seedless watermelon, feta cheese, mint leaves, and olive oil for a refreshing salad that's perfect for outdoor entertaining.
Watermelon Fruit Salad
Toss together cubes of seedless watermelon, and 1 cup of each of the following- cantaloupe, cubed peaches, blueberries, blackberries, and green grapes. Gently toss in a bowl.
Grilled Watermelon
Slice a seedless watermelon into 1-inch thick rounds and brush them lightly with oil. Grill over medium heat until you have grill marks on both sides, and then drizzle with honey or agave nectar before serving.
Watermelon Juice
For an easy summer cooler, blend chunks of seedless watermelon in a blender until smooth and strain through a sieve if desired. This juice makes an excellent base for homemade mocktails. Optional- add lemon, lime, ginger or mint! More watermelon juice recipe here.
Coconut and Watermelon drink
Mix together 1 cup coconut water, 2 cups watermelon, ½ tsp lime juice and 1 cup of ice. Blend until smooth . Then add 2 tbsp chia seeds and a dash of salt. Mix again. Full recipe here!
